Output e6d9a9d8ffec4d71c30ab54018640aec8a83cfb0b53db595875dbe74cb650e70:6

value
154378818
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75d54c634a61346c534a654da773d53f56561123 OP_EQUAL
address
3CS4WDhtvRFreLME2qizHhiVFPCJY1ZNoE
transaction
e6d9a9d8ffec4d71c30ab54018640aec8a83cfb0b53db595875dbe74cb650e70
spent
true